Frankly, this stuff sucks as a regular conditioner. The only way I use it, as was recommended to me by my stylist, is as a leave-in conditioner. Used this way it's great- leaves my hair silky, tangle-free and soft, while protecting my color and highlights. If you are having bad luck after using it as you would a normal conditioner where you rinse it out, try a little as a leave-in and I promise you'll see a difference.
